声张 (shēng zhāng) — to make known, to divulge (especially something intended to be kept secret)
Definition
A formal verb meaning to make something known, typically a secret or sensitive matter — almost always used in the negative (不要声张) or with the particle 出去 (声张出去).
verb
to make knownto divulge (especially something intended to be kept secret)
